President, PM reiterate Pakistan's firm resolve to completely eradicate menace of terrorism

President Dr. Arif Alvi and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if have reiterated Pakistan's firm resolve to completely eradicate the menace of terrorism. 

In his message on the occasion of 8th anniversary of Army Public School,Presidnet Alvi said no act of terrorism can weaken our resolve against this menace.He said the entire nation is united to eradicate the remnants of terrorism.

The President said the 16th December will always remind us of the great sacrifices of the martyrs of Army Public School. He said even after eight years, the memory of this heartbreaking incident is still fresh in our hearts.

Arif Alvi said this day is also a reminder to the international community that terrorism is a common problem for all of us and we must accelerate our efforts to eliminate it from the world.

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if in his tweets on Friday said this day gives a message to the whole world that Pakistan has rendered immense sacrifices to eradicate terrorism.

He said our struggle is continuing and it will continue with the same iron will and perseverance until the complete elimination of this menace.

Shehbaz Sharif said the 16th December reminds the entire nation of the pain and agony of the terrorist act  that took place in Army Public School, Peshawar. Even after several years, this pain has not been forgotten.

The Prime Minister said this is the day to pay tribute to the martyrs of the tragedy and share the grief of their families. He said Pakistani nation will never forget the sacrifices of its martyrs.

In her message on the occasion of 8th anniversary of Army Public School tragedy, Minister for Information and Broadcasting Marriyum Aurangzeb has said the nation has come a long way to defeat terrorism.

She said we are moving towards lasting peace and development in Pakistan.

The Information Minister said the nation has still not forgotten the Army Public School tragedy regardless of passage of eight years.

She said the cowardly militant elements attacked the future of nation and martyred the innocent children. She said nobody can hold back their tears while remembering this day.

Marriyum Aurangzeb said the 16th December will continue to remind us of the great sacrifices of martyrs.

The Information Minister prayed for those martyred in Army Public School tragedy.
